BuyWhere launches specialized e-commerce API for AI agents

BuyWhere is presented as a specialized e-commerce data API designed for AI agents, contrasting with more general-purpose scraping tools like SerpAPI Shopping, Oxylabs E-commerce Scraper, and ScraperAPI. BuyWhere offers a normalized JSON output and an MCP server optimized for agent use, simplifying product lookups, price comparisons, and affiliate link generation. While general scrapers can perform these tasks, they require significant development effort for data normalization, currency conversion, and integration, making BuyWhere a more efficient solution for AI agents focused on e-commerce tasks, particularly in regions like Southeast Asia and the US.
